Whatever level of detail one chooses, the energy
in the forward waves plus the energy in the reflected
waves will equal the total energy in the transmission
line which will always be the energy sourced and not
delivered to the load (in a lossless system). This
will be true right down to the last photon.
Unless someone can prove that EM energy is
transformed into some other form of energy for
storage in the transmission line and then transformed
back to EM energy when the transmission line is
emptied, the nature of EM energy and the conservation
of energy principle dictate what happens. EM (photonic)
wave energy cannot move at less than the speed of
light (modified by VF).
